Margin ≠ markup

Margin divides profit by the selling price; markup divides it by cost. A $60 cost sold at $100 is a 40% margin but a 66.7% markup. Mixing them up misprices products — a '50% markup' yields only a 33% margin.

Setting price from a target margin

To hit a target margin, divide cost by (1 − margin): a $60 cost priced for a 40% margin is 60 ÷ 0.6 = $100. Pricing by adding a percentage to cost (markup) systematically undershoots the margin you named.
